Banff National Park — 2 nights

On the 13th (Tue), take a memorable drive along Bow Valley Parkway and then explore the activities along Peyto Lake. Get ready for a full day of sightseeing on the 14th (Wed): cruise along Morant's Curve, then explore the activities along Lake Louise, and then contemplate the waterfront views at Moraine Lake.

To see photos, reviews, ratings, and other tourist information, use the Banff National Park trip itinerary maker app.

Traveling by flight from Toronto to Banff National Park takes 6 hours. Alternatively, you can drive; or do a combination of train, car, and bus. The time zone difference moving from Eastern Standard Time to Mountain Standard Time is minus 2 hours. When traveling from Toronto in June, plan for a bit cooler days in Banff National Park, with highs around 20°C, while nights are cooler with lows around 3°C. Jasper National Park — 3 nights

On the 15th (Thu), take in the awesome beauty at Whistlers Peak, admire the sheer force of Athabasca Falls, then explore and take pictures at Highway 93A, and finally take in the exciting artwork at Jasper Art Gallery. Here are some ideas for day two: explore the activities along Pyramid and Patricia Lakes, contemplate the waterfront views at Annette Lake, then explore the stunning scenery at Maligne Canyon, and finally hike along Old Fort Point Loop Trail.

For reviews, where to stay, and tourist information, read our Jasper National Park sightseeing planner.

Traveling by car from Banff National Park to Jasper National Park takes 3 hours. Alternatively, you can take a bus. When traveling from Banff National Park in June, plan for somewhat warmer days and about the same nights in Jasper National Park: temperatures range from 24°C by day to 5°C at night.
